The Mt. Moriah Christian Academy has been in existence for almost 30 years.
It was founded under the direction of Rev. Jerry B. West.
The Academy began in the basement of Mt. Moriah Church of God In Christ as a daycare but has grown by the grace of God to become an academy of the community.
Though this school is one of excellence it remains affordable because Rev. West saw the need for a Christian School which addressed the masses.
Rev. West realized that if the lack of affordable Christian School were address it could have a major positive impact on the community.
God has blessed the school to develop into a true academy, serving grades Pre-K through the 6th Grade.
Though the school is still very affordable, it has not sacrificed it's quality, providing excellent education & training which encourages students to become the leaders of tomorrow.
Over the years, Mt. Moriah Christian Academy has become a landmark of the community.
It has produced many honors students who have gone onto remain honor students after graduating for Mt. Moriah because of the work habits and ideals they developed at Mt. Moriah.
The school encourages it's student to go beyond the required curriculum which in turn allows a student to develop to his/hers full potential.
